Allan Okello Clinches Third Individual Award After Stellar May Performances

Uganda Cranes midfielder Allan Okello has added another accolade to his growing collection after being named the NBC Premier League Player of the Month for May.

The Young Africans playmaker has now won three individual awards for his outstanding performances during the month.

Okello first claimed the Footballer of the Month award at the Fortebet Real Stars Sports Monthly Awards before being named Young Africans’ NIC Insurance Player of the Month.

He has now been recognised as the best player in Tanzania’s top-flight league for May.

The former Vipers SC star enjoyed a remarkable month, scoring nine goals and providing one assist in seven matches to register 10 goal contributions.

Since joining Young Africans at the start of 2026, Okello has established himself as one of the club’s most influential players and a key figure in their success.

His impressive performances have not only earned him individual recognition but have also attracted interest from several clubs abroad.

Turkish giants Fenerbahçe are reportedly among the leading contenders for his signature should negotiations progress and all parties reach an agreement.

With his form continuing to improve, Okello remains one of the most outstanding Ugandan footballers currently playing outside the country.
